Hiking around Jossgrund is set within the Hessian Spessart Nature Park, a forested low mountain range characterized by deep valleys, clear streams, and varied topography. The region features extensive stretches of ancient oak and beech trees, alongside unique natural monuments like the Beilstein Basalt Formation. Trails often follow the gentle Jossa Valley, offering views of the surrounding green hillsides and distant forested peaks.

Jossgrund Loop The slopes of the Jossa Valley, which extend up to higher elevations, repeatedly treat hikers to expansive views on this tour. The starting point is directly at the former moated castle with its mighty walls in Burgjoss. You'll experience the meandering Jossa River, beautiful forest edges, and idyllic meadow valleys. A beautiful trail with great variety, thanks to the frequent changes between forest and open countryside. See: https://www.wanderinstitut.de/premiumwege/hessen/jossgrund-runde/

Frequently Asked Questions

How many hiking trails are available in Jossgrund?

Jossgrund offers a wide variety of hiking opportunities, with over 180 routes recorded on komoot. These include 100 easy trails, 85 moderate routes, and a few more challenging options, ensuring there's something for every fitness level.

What kind of landscapes can I expect to see while hiking in Jossgrund?

Jossgrund is nestled within the Hessian Spessart Nature Park, characterized by extensive forests of ancient oak and beech trees, deep valleys, and clear streams. You'll encounter unique natural features like the Beilstein Basalt Formation, rare juniper heaths, and the gentle Jossa Valley, often with panoramic views of the surrounding green hillsides.

Are there any circular hiking routes in Jossgrund?

Yes, Jossgrund is known for its excellent circular hiking trails. The region features premium circular routes like the Spessartfährten, designed for day trips. An example is the Jossgrund Loop with a food break, which offers diverse impressions, river views, and panoramic vistas.

What are some notable natural landmarks or points of interest to explore?

Hikers can discover several unique landmarks. The Beilstein Basalt Formation is a significant natural monument and one of Hesse's oldest nature reserves. You might also encounter rare juniper heaths, the tranquil Jossa Valley, and the Wiesbüttmoor Nature Reserve.

Are there any historical sites along the trails?

Yes, the region blends natural beauty with historical intrigue. The Beilstein Ruins and Viewpoint loop from Jossgrund leads to the ruins of a high medieval castle on the summit plateau of Beilstein. Additionally, the impressive ruins of the 12th-century Burg Jossa (Water Castle) in Burgjoss serve as a historical starting point for many hikes.

What do other hikers say about the trails in Jossgrund?

The hiking routes in Jossgrund are highly regarded by the komoot community, holding an average rating of 4.6 stars from over 1500 reviews. Hikers often praise the well-maintained paths, the diverse scenery, and the immersive natural experience provided by the ancient forests and tranquil valleys.

Are there any family-friendly hiking options in Jossgrund?

Jossgrund offers various trails suitable for families. The Burgwiesenpark in Burgjoss, adjacent to the water castle, provides a relaxing space with a playground and a Kneipp pool, making it an excellent starting or ending point for a family outing. Many of the easy and moderate circular trails are also well-suited for families.

Can I find places to rest or get refreshments during my hike?

Yes, several routes offer opportunities for breaks. The Jossgrund Loop with a food break is specifically designed with this in mind. The Schafhof Café in Burgjoss, situated in an old sheep farm, is an ideal stop for refreshments and regional products during or after a hike.

Are there any trails that feature water elements like lakes or streams?

Many trails in Jossgrund follow the gentle Jossa rivulet, offering scenic views of the water. You can also find routes that pass by beautiful lakes such as Wiesbüttsee and Hasel Pond, providing tranquil spots for a break.

What is the best time of year to go hiking in Jossgrund?

Jossgrund is appealing throughout the year, but spring and autumn are particularly popular. In spring, the forests burst with new life, while autumn offers stunning foliage colors. The extensive tree cover also provides pleasant shade during warmer summer months, and winter hiking can be serene, though conditions may vary.

Are there any unique wildlife encounters possible on the trails?

The protected juniper heaths in the area serve as habitats for various wildlife, including the adder. Hikers on premium trails like the Jossgrund Loop might also encounter shaggy and robust Highland cattle, adding a unique pastoral charm to the experience.

Are there options for shorter, easier walks in Jossgrund?

Absolutely. Jossgrund offers 100 easy trails, many of which are shorter circular routes. These are perfect for a leisurely stroll or for those looking for less strenuous options, allowing you to enjoy the natural beauty without a demanding hike. An example is the Hopp's Beeches loop from Jossgrund, which is around 8.5 km.
